Course Content

• Understanding the Financial Needs of the Elderly
• Retirement Income Planning & Strategies
• Long-Term Care Financing: Insurance & Medicaid
• Estate Planning for Seniors: Wills, Trusts & Probate
• Elder Financial Abuse & Exploitation Prevention
• Tax Planning for Retirement & Estate
• Healthcare Costs & Financial Management
• Government Benefits & Entitlements for Seniors (Social Security, Medicare)

Awarding body

The programme is awarded by London School of International Business. This program is not intended to replace or serve as an equivalent to obtaining a formal degree or diploma. It should be noted that this course is not accredited by a recognised awarding body or regulated by an authorised institution/ body.

Career path

Career Role Description
Elderly Financial Planner Develops and implements financial plans for elderly clients, considering retirement income, long-term care, and estate planning. High demand due to aging population.
Financial Advisor (Elderly Care Focus) Provides specialized financial advice to older adults, focusing on retirement planning, investments, and managing assets. Strong market need for specialized knowledge.
Retirement Planning Specialist Specializes in helping individuals plan for a financially secure retirement, including pension optimization and annuity selection. Crucial role in the aging population sector.
Estate Planner (Elderly Focus) Assists elderly clients in planning for the distribution of their assets after death, including wills, trusts, and probate. Increasing demand due to inheritance laws.
